Background
In the engineering machinery industry, the market competition is extremely violent, and the market capacity of the rubber-wheel road roller is small. The existing operation mode is continuously improved by each road roller manufacturer, and the aim is to continuously improve the production efficiency and the product quality of products so as to reduce the production cost and obtain greater benefits.
The rubber-tyred road roller comprises a left rear wheel assembly and a right rear wheel assembly, wherein the parts used by the two rear wheel assemblies are important components of a walking system of the rubber-tyred road roller, the structure of the rear wheel assembly of the rubber-tyred road roller is shown in fig. 1, the rear wheel assembly comprises a rubber wheel 11, a rectangular bearing box 12, a rubber wheel 11, a chain wheel 14, a rectangular bearing box 12 and a rubber wheel 11 which are sequentially arranged from left to right through a rotating shaft 13, strip-shaped clamping grooves 15 are formed in the upper part and the lower part of the bearing box 12, the assembly efficiency of the rear wheel assembly directly influences the production efficiency of the whole machine during production and assembly, the quality of tires and other painted parts in the rear wheel assembly directly influences the appearance quality of the whole machine, the assembly of the rear wheel assembly adopts a travelling crane to lift a main frame, a forklift to support the rear wheel assembly, the assembly is assembled by slowly adjusting the installation position, the forklift after the rear wheel assembly is adjusted in place, the rear wheel assembly is collided to the installation position by the impact force, and the safety of workpieces are easily collided.

The utility model has the advantages that: 1. through micro adjustment in the vertical direction of the jack and sliding adjustment in the front-back direction of the guide rail and the guide rail seat, the rear wheel assembly can be assembled on line in a limited space or without hoisting equipment, the assembly efficiency of the whole machine is improved, the assembly operation difficulty of the rear wheel assembly is reduced, and the labor cost is saved; 2. a limiting device is additionally arranged on the rear side of the base, so that the rear wheel assembly is prevented from sliding on the underframe, and the operation safety is ensured; 3. the problems of collision, scratch and the like in the use process of a traveling crane and a forklift can be effectively avoided, and the assembly quality is ensured; 4. the inclined strut is additionally arranged in front of the base, so that the rear wheel assembly can roll on the bottom frame conveniently, and the practicability is good.

Detailed Description
The following describes the embodiments of the present invention with reference to the drawings in step .
As shown in the accompanying drawings, the rear wheel assembly of the existing rubber-tyred roller comprises a rubber tyred 11, a rectangular bearing box 12, a rubber tyred 11, a sprocket 14, a rectangular bearing box 12, and a rubber tyred 11 (see fig. 1) which are sequentially installed through a rotating shaft 13 from left to right, and strip-shaped slots 15 are formed on the upper and lower sides of the bearing box 12 (the upper portion is provided with a slot to facilitate positioning and installation with an upper main frame). The rear wheel assembly assembling device of the rubber-tyred roller comprises a base 1, wherein the base 1 is of a rectangular framework structure welded by C-shaped steel, two longitudinal horizontal middle beams are welded in the middle of the base 1, the distance between the two middle beams is adaptive to the distance between two bearing boxes 12, the distance between the left outer beam and the right outer beam of the base 1 is adaptive to the distance between two outer rubber wheels 11 of the rear wheel assembly, two middle beams in the middle of the base 1 are fixedly connected with a fixed plate 5 through bolts, a vertical hydraulic jack 17 is fixed on the fixed plate 5 through bolts, a guide positioning seat 6 is fixed at the shaft end of the hydraulic jack 17, the guide positioning seat 6 comprises a guide sleeve at the lower part and a mounting seat at the upper part, vertical limiting plates are mounted at the front side and the rear side of the mounting seat through bolts, a horizontal longitudinal guide rail 7 is fixed on the mounting seat, a guide rail seat 8 capable of sliding back and forth, a support seat 9 is fixedly arranged on the guide rail seat 8, and an L-shaped insert block 16 matched with the clamping groove 15 is fixedly arranged above the support seat 9. The rear ends of the left outer beam and the right outer beam of the base 1 are fixedly provided with limiting seats 4.
When the rear wheel assembly assembling device of the rubber-tyred roller is used, a base 1 is placed at a proper position, an inclined strut 10 with a triangular cross section is installed in front of the base 1 (as shown in figure 2), so that a rear wheel assembly rolls onto the base 1 along the inclined plane of the inclined strut 10 (or a crane is hoisted and placed), rubber wheels 11 on two outer sides of the rear wheel assembly are rightly pressed on two outer beams of the base frame 1 until the rubber wheels 11 are stopped to be contacted with a limiting seat 4 (limiting and anti-rolling), hydraulic jacks 17 on the left side and the right side are operated to be ejected out, two inserting blocks 16 on the upper end are inserted into clamping grooves 15 on the lower parts of two bearing boxes 12, the whole rear wheel assembly is supported and finely adjusted upwards, then the front and rear positions of guide rail seats 9 on the two sides are adjusted in a sliding manner, the rear wheel assembly reaches the proper installation position of a main frame, the clamping grooves 15 on the upper parts of the bearing boxes, finally, the jacks 17 on the two sides are released and descended, and the on-line installation of the whole rear wheel assembly is completed.
The rear wheel assembly assembling device of the rubber-tyred road roller is simple in structure and convenient to operate, can greatly improve the mounting efficiency of the rear wheel assembly, saves labor cost, can avoid the problems of collision, scratch and the like in the use process of a driving vehicle and a forklift, and is stable and reliable in mounting and good in safety.
